Throwing Knife Right-Handed

$12.00

Maple Knife for working on wheel. Helps you cut off excess clay perfectly for easy wiring and removal. Helps eliminate the need for bats for smaller pieces. The chisel tip is great for cutting hand-cut feet on bowls and cups and for all-around carving. This Right-Hand knife is for working with the wheel rotating counter-clockwise. Dimensions are approximate: 8-1/4 x 3/4 x 1/2

To keep them working well; oil with mineral oil periodically and sharpen with 150-220 sandpaper. Sharpening video: YouTube
